Step 1
Add the unsalted butter and sugars to a bowl and beat until creamy.
Step 2
Add in the egg, and beat again. If using vanilla, add it in now!
Step 3
Add in the plain flour, finely crushed oreo crumbs (leave the creme middle in the oreo when crushing, I use a food processor to get a fine crumb) baking powder, bicarbonate of soda, and salt and beat until a cookie dough is formed!
Step 4
Add in the chocolate chips, and chopped oreos and beat until they're distributed well!
Step 5
Weigh your cookies out into eight cookie dough balls - they're about 125-130g each!
Step 6
Once they're rolled into balls, put your cookie dough in the freezer for at least 30 minutes, or in the fridge for an hour or so!
Step 7
Whilst the cookie dough is chilling, preheat your oven to 180C Fan, or 200C regular! If your oven runs hot, go for 160C-170c.
Step 8
Take your cookies out of the freezer/fridge and put onto a lined baking tray. I put four cookies per tray!
Step 9
Bake the cookies in the oven for 12-14 minutes - Once baked, leave them to cool on the tray for at least 30 minutes, as they will continue to bake whilst cooling!
Step 10
ENJOY!
